About Beaumont Independent School District's H-1B Sponsorship
Beaumont Independent School District has filed 5 H-1B visa petitions with a 80.0% approval rate. Beaumont ISD shows a consistent pattern of H-1B sponsorship, with 5 petitions filed in FY2025. The employer primarily sponsors teaching positions, with ELAR and Spanish Teachers being the most frequent roles. All sponsored positions are located in Texas, indicating a localized hiring strategy. The average salary offered is competitive within the education sector, aligning with market rates.
